5-member team formed to probe Dr Arsalan case
04 July, 2012
ISLAMABAD: A five-member joint investigation team was constituted by the National Accountability Bureau (NAB) chairman on Tuesday to investigate the Arsalan Iftikhar case. The team is headed by the NAB Financial Crimes Investigation Wing DG. It includes one member each from the FIA and police, and three members from NAB. In its first meeting, the team decided to collect relevant material from the quarters concerned within a week to proceed further. The meeting was held at the NAB Headquarters. It was decided in the meeting that the committee would contact the people concerned to collect information relevant to the case and analyse the collected facts before proceeding further. Earlier this month, the Supreme Court had directed the government to conduct an inquiry into the case. End.
